Fremantle Weather: What to Expect Year-Round

Fremantle enjoys a Mediterranean climate with warm, dry summers and mild, wet winters, making it a year-round destination. Planning your visit around the cooler months can enhance outdoor activities, while summer brings vibrant beach life.

The distance between Busselton and Fremantle is approximately 183.5 km by road. The typical travel time by car is 2 hours and 24 minutes. If you prefer public transportation, it takes about 3 hours and 51 minutes to reach Fremantle from Busselton by taking a bus and then a train via Mandurah. The bus journey alone takes around 3 hours and 31 minutes.
The most cost-effective option for traveling from Busselton to Fremantle would be by taking a bus and train via Mandurah. This option typically costs between $24 and $35 and takes approximately 3 hours and 51 minutes. However, if time efficiency is a priority, driving would be the fastest option, taking around 2 hours and 24 minutes. The cost for driving is estimated to be between $27 and $40.
The prices for a bus ticket between Fremantle and Busselton can range from $23 to $45, depending on the operator and the type of ticket purchased.
To get from Busselton to Fremantle without using public transportation, you can drive the distance of 220.5 km which takes about 2 hours and 24 minutes. The cost of this option varies from $27 to $40 based on fuel consumption.
To travel from Busselton to Fremantle without a car, the best option is to take a bus. The journey takes approximately 3 hours and 31 minutes and the cost ranges from $23 to $45.
No, there is no direct link between Busselton and Fremantle by bus. However, there are bus services operated by South West Coach Lines that can take you from Busselton to Fremantle with a transfer at Cockburn Central Station. The journey takes approximately 3 hours and 31 minutes.
